Web13 okt. 2024 · If you look closely, both the human and canine spines have 7 vertebrae in the neck (cervical), humans have 12 (vs 13 in dogs) vertebrae in the mid back (thoracic spine), and 5 (vs 7 in the canine spine) in the lower back (lumbar spine). The average dog has 26 vertebrae. 7 cervical, 13 thoracic, and 6 lumbar. Web10 nov. 2014 · 5. Tail vertebrae. There are between 18 and 22 tail vertebrae, which run to the end of the dock. By examining the development of bones in the vertebral column, limbs, and ribcage, scientists at the University of Cambridge have discovered how sloths evolved their unique neck skeleton. From mice to giraffes, mammals are remarkable in that all but a handful of their 5000 species have exactly seven vertebrae in the neck. inchcape shipping services dubai l.l.cWebAll thoracic vertebrae have a pair of costal facets on the dorsal body (except T13) forming costal fovea.
